Nehemiah 9:13 Meaning and Commentary

Nehemiah 9:13

Thou camest down also upon Mount Sinai
By some visible tokens of his presence, as a cloud, fire, smoke which must be understood consistent with his omniscience, see ( Exodus 19:18 ) ,

and spakest with them from heaven;
the decalogue or ten commandments, ( Exodus 20:1-17 ) ,

and gavest them right judgments and true laws, good statutes and
commandments;
both judicial and ceremonial, which were of excellent use to them in their civil and ecclesiastical polity; these were not spoken to Israel, but given to Moses on the mount, to be delivered to them.
